Roof Shingles Replacement in Framingham, MA
Roof shingle replacement services involve removing damaged or aging shingles and installing new ones to restore the roof’s integrity and appearance. This type of project typically covers residential homes experiencing issues such as missing, cracked, curling, or worn shingles, as well as complete roof overhauls when shingles have reached the end of their lifespan. Homeowners often seek this service to prevent leaks, improve curb appeal, or address storm damage, and they usually want to understand the different shingle options available, the scope of the replacement process, and how it can impact the overall durability of their roof.
Before requesting roof shingle replacement, property owners should consider factors such as the condition of their current roofing system, the types of shingles that suit their style and budget, and the expected lifespan of the new materials. It’s also helpful to know if additional repairs, such as replacing underlayment or addressing structural issues, are necessary to ensure a long-lasting result. Understanding the extent of the project and the options available can help homeowners make informed decisions to protect their property and enhance its appearance.

Roof Shingles Replacement Questions
What are signs that roof shingles need replacement? Visible damage such as curling, cracking, missing shingles, or granule loss indicate the need for replacement.
How long do roof shingles typically last? The lifespan of roof shingles varies depending on material, but generally ranges from 15 to 30 years.
Can damaged shingles be repaired instead of replaced? Minor damage may be repairable, but extensive deterioration usually requires full shingle replacement.
What types of shingles are commonly used for replacement? Asphalt shingles are most common, with options including architectural and traditional styles to suit different preferences.
